Danny Gagliardi is a former professional soccer player. He was drafted in the 2020 MLS Superdraft by the Vancouver Whitecaps. Following the Whitecaps, he played for Inter Miami, FC Tulsa, and the Miami FC.
Danny played collegiate soccer at Florida International University, spending five seasons with the Panthers. He made 34 appearances and was named Third Team All-Conference USA in 2019. He graduated with a degree in Kinesiology and is a certified personal trainer.
Following his pro career, he accepted a role at Lipscomb University as Goalkeeper Coach where he continues to grow and learn from the game.
